域名备案  备案888是国内领先正规代备案公司,专业代理网站备案、域名备案、快速备案、ICP备案、个人备案、企业备案、备案查询、已备案域名交易等服务,增加认证域名,过Q域名,防拦截域名等服务。另提供域名注册,域名抢注等服务。
设为首页
繁体中文
  • 联系我们
  • 下载中心
  • 备案留言
  • 备案查询
  • 认证域名
  • 备案价格
  • 新闻中心
  • 公司简介
  • 首页
  • 今天是:
新闻分类
推荐新闻
图片新闻
  当前位置:首页 >> 新闻中心 >> 其它新闻 >> 查看新闻
HTTPS跟HTTP一样只不过增加了SSL
作者:域名备案 网站备案  来源:www.beian888.com  发表时间:2019-5-17 10:07:20

什么是 HTTPS?

HTTPS (基于安全套接字层的超文本传输协议 或者是 HTTP over SSL) 是一个 Netscape 开发的 Web 协议。也可以说:HTTPS = HTTP + SSL

HTTPS 在 HTTP 应用层的基础上使用安全套接字层作为子层。

为什么需要 HTTPS ?

超文本传输协议 (HTTP) 是一个用来通过互联网传输和接收信息的协议。HTTP 使用请求/响应的过程,因此信息可在服务器间快速、轻松而且精确的进行传输。当你访问 Web 页面的时候你就是在使用 HTTP 协议,但 HTTP 是不安全的,可以轻松对窃听你跟 Web 服务器之间的数据传输。在很多情况下,客户和服务器之间传输的是敏感歇息,需要防止未经授权的访问。为了满足这个要求,网景公司(Netscape)推出了HTTPS,也就是基于安全套接字层的 HTTP 协议。

HTTP 和 HTTPS 的相同点。

大多数情况下,HTTP 和 HTTPS 是相同的,因为都是采用同一个基础的协议,作为 HTTP 或 HTTPS 客户端——浏览器,设立一个连接到 Web 服务器指定的端口。当服务器接收到请求,它会返回一个状态码以及消息,这个回应可能是请求信息、或者指示某个错误发送的错误信息。系统使用统一资源定位器 URI 模式,因此资源可以被唯一指定。而 HTTPS 和 HTTP 唯一不同的只是一个协议头(https)的说明,其他都是一样的。

HTTP 和 HTTPS 的不同之处。

1.HTTP 的 URL 以 http:// 开头,而 HTTPS 的 URL 以 https:// 开头

2.HTTP 是不安全的,而 HTTPS 是安全的

3.HTTP 标准端口是 80 ,而 HTTPS 的标准端口是 443

4.在 OSI 网络模型中,HTTP 工作于应用层,而 HTTPS 工作在传输层

5.HTTP 无需加密,而 HTTPS 对传输的数据进行加密

6.HTTP 无需证书,而 HTTPS 需要认证证书

7.HTTPS 如何工作?

使用 HTTPS 连接时,服务器要求有公钥和签名的证书。

当使用 https 连接,服务器响应初始连接,并提供它所支持的加密方法。作为回应,客户端选择一个连接方法,并且客户端和服务器端交换证书验证彼此身份。完成之后,在确保使用相同密钥的情况下传输加密信息,然后关闭连接。为了提供 https 连接支持,服务器必须有一个公钥证书,该证书包含经过证书机构认证的密钥信息,大部分证书都是通过第三方机构授权的,以保证证书是安全的。

换句话说,HTTPS 跟 HTTP 一样,只不过增加了 SSL。

HTTP 包含如下动作:

1.浏览器打开一个 TCP 连接

2.浏览器发送 HTTP 请求到服务器端

3.服务器发送 HTTP 回应信息到浏览器

4.TCP 连接关闭

SSL 包含如下动作:

1.验证服务器端

2.允许客户端和服务器端选择加密算法和密码,确保双方都支持

3.验证客户端(可选)

4.使用公钥加密技术来生成共享加密数据

5.创建一个加密的 SSL 连接

6.基于该 SSL 连接传递 HTTP 请求

什么时候该使用 HTTPS?

银行网站、支付网关、购物网站、登录页、电子邮件以及一些企业部门的网站应该使用 HTTPS

 

上条新闻:小程序诞生的背景是什么小程序到底有哪些优势
下条新闻:爱贷网的老板朱新琴是一位80后